.site-map_page__bE1mj{display:grid;gap:clamp(18px,2vw,26px)}.site-map_hero__aKTfQ{position:relative;overflow:hidden;display:grid;gap:18px;padding:clamp(24px,4vw,40px);border-radius:34px;border:3px solid var(--neo-outline);background:radial-gradient(circle at top right,rgba(255,182,64,.18),transparent 28%),radial-gradient(circle at left 22%,rgba(107,176,255,.16),transparent 32%),linear-gradient(180deg,rgba(255,253,248,.98),rgba(248,244,235,.96));box-shadow:8px 8px 0 var(--neo-shadow-soft)}.site-map_hero__aKTfQ:after,.site-map_hero__aKTfQ:before{content:"";position:absolute;border:3px solid var(--neo-outline);border-radius:22px;box-shadow:5px 5px 0 var(--neo-shadow-soft)}.site-map_hero__aKTfQ:before{right:2.4rem;top:1.8rem;width:84px;height:84px;background:#d8ebff;transform:rotate(9deg)}.site-map_hero__aKTfQ:after{left:2rem;bottom:-2.3rem;width:124px;height:124px;background:#ffe5bf;transform:rotate(-10deg)}.site-map_eyebrow__u2_aU{display:inline-flex;align-items:center;gap:8px;width:-moz-fit-content;width:fit-content;padding:8px 14px;border-radius:999px;border:3px solid var(--neo-outline);color:#c36a11;background:rgba(255,255,255,.92);box-shadow:4px 4px 0 var(--neo-shadow-soft);font-size:.76rem;font-weight:800;letter-spacing:.08em;text-transform:uppercase}.site-map_heroCopy__VVrqP{position:relative;z-index:1;display:grid;gap:10px}.site-map_title__dPoUn{margin:0;color:var(--text-primary);font-size:clamp(2.5rem,6vw,4.3rem);line-height:.95;letter-spacing:-.05em}.site-map_subtitle__EdQCn{margin:0;max-width:760px;color:var(--text-secondary);font-size:1rem;line-height:1.7}.site-map_inlineCode__7z9Zo{display:inline-flex;align-items:center;padding:.1rem .45rem;border-radius:999px;border:2px solid var(--neo-outline);background:rgba(255,255,255,.92);color:var(--text-primary);font-family:inherit;font-size:.92em;font-weight:700;box-shadow:2px 2px 0 var(--neo-shadow-soft)}.site-map_heroMeta__bEAs0{position:relative;z-index:1;display:grid;gap:14px;grid-template-columns:repeat(auto-fit,minmax(190px,1fr))}.site-map_heroCard__HEcIo{display:grid;gap:8px;min-height:148px;padding:18px;border-radius:24px;border:3px solid var(--neo-outline);background:rgba(255,255,255,.9);box-shadow:5px 5px 0 var(--neo-shadow-soft)}.site-map_heroCard__HEcIo:nth-child(2){background:linear-gradient(155deg,#eef8ff,#dfeeff)}.site-map_heroCard__HEcIo:nth-child(3){background:linear-gradient(155deg,#fff8ef,#ffe7be)}.site-map_heroCardLabel__3HDVX,.site-map_sectionEyebrow__gPy3F{color:var(--text-muted);font-size:.78rem;font-weight:800;letter-spacing:.08em;text-transform:uppercase}.site-map_heroCardValue__h1_PT{font-size:1.45rem;font-weight:800;letter-spacing:-.04em;color:var(--text-primary)}.site-map_heroCardText__Ar9A7{color:var(--text-secondary);font-size:.94rem;line-height:1.58}.site-map_grid__mfRLn{display:grid;gap:18px}.site-map_sectionCard__YezI9{display:grid;gap:18px;padding:22px;border-radius:28px;border:3px solid var(--neo-outline);background:linear-gradient(180deg,rgba(255,255,255,.96),rgba(251,247,238,.96));box-shadow:6px 6px 0 var(--neo-shadow-soft)}.site-map_sectionHeader__0rMXF{display:grid;gap:10px}.site-map_sectionTitle__sDNQf{margin:0;color:var(--text-primary);font-size:1.45rem}.site-map_sectionDescription__dbzW0{margin:0;color:var(--text-secondary);line-height:1.65}.site-map_linksGrid__utbfs{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:14px}.site-map_linkCard__54eRR{display:grid;gap:12px;padding:18px;border-radius:22px;border:3px solid var(--neo-outline);background:linear-gradient(180deg,rgba(255,255,255,.98),rgba(250,246,239,.96));color:inherit;text-decoration:none;transition:transform .18s ease,box-shadow .18s ease;box-shadow:4px 4px 0 var(--neo-shadow-soft)}.site-map_linkCard__54eRR:hover{transform:translate(2px,2px);box-shadow:2px 2px 0 var(--neo-shadow-soft)}.site-map_linkHead__XUkMK{display:flex;align-items:flex-start;gap:12px}.site-map_linkIcon__KGsTE{display:inline-flex;align-items:center;justify-content:center;width:40px;height:40px;border-radius:15px;border:3px solid var(--neo-outline);background:#fff4dc;color:#c36a11;box-shadow:4px 4px 0 var(--neo-shadow-soft)}.site-map_linkMeta__K4IK5{display:grid;gap:6px;min-width:0}.site-map_linkTitle__5AFE2{color:var(--text-primary);font-size:1rem;font-weight:800}.site-map_authBadge__pprJk{width:-moz-fit-content;width:fit-content;padding:5px 10px;border-radius:999px;border:2px solid var(--neo-outline);background:#ffe7be;color:#9f560d;font-size:.74rem;font-weight:700;box-shadow:2px 2px 0 var(--neo-shadow-soft)}.site-map_linkDescription__KtHPb{margin:0;color:var(--text-secondary);line-height:1.65}.dark .site-map_hero__aKTfQ{background:radial-gradient(circle at top right,rgba(255,182,64,.18),transparent 28%),radial-gradient(circle at left 22%,rgba(107,176,255,.16),transparent 32%),linear-gradient(180deg,rgba(42,28,17,.96),rgba(25,19,15,.98));box-shadow:8px 8px 0 rgba(0,0,0,.34)}.dark .site-map_eyebrow__u2_aU{background:rgba(255,255,255,.06);color:#ffd59c}.dark .site-map_heroCardValue__h1_PT,.dark .site-map_linkTitle__5AFE2,.dark .site-map_sectionTitle__sDNQf,.dark .site-map_title__dPoUn{color:var(--text-primary)}.dark .site-map_hero__aKTfQ:before{background:rgba(107,176,255,.22)}.dark .site-map_hero__aKTfQ:after{background:rgba(255,182,64,.18)}.dark .site-map_heroCardText__Ar9A7,.dark .site-map_linkDescription__KtHPb,.dark .site-map_sectionDescription__dbzW0,.dark .site-map_subtitle__EdQCn{color:var(--text-secondary)}.dark .site-map_inlineCode__7z9Zo{background:rgba(255,255,255,.08);color:var(--text-primary)}.dark .site-map_heroCardLabel__3HDVX,.dark .site-map_heroCard__HEcIo,.dark .site-map_linkCard__54eRR,.dark .site-map_sectionCard__YezI9{background:rgba(255,255,255,.04);box-shadow:4px 4px 0 rgba(0,0,0,.38)}.dark .site-map_heroCard__HEcIo:nth-child(2){background:rgba(107,176,255,.14)}.dark .site-map_heroCard__HEcIo:nth-child(3){background:rgba(255,182,64,.12)}.dark .site-map_authBadge__pprJk{background:rgba(255,182,64,.16);color:#ffd59c}.dark .site-map_heroCardLabel__3HDVX,.dark .site-map_sectionEyebrow__gPy3F{color:var(--text-muted)}.dark .site-map_linkCard__54eRR:hover{box-shadow:2px 2px 0 rgba(0,0,0,.38)}.dark .site-map_linkIcon__KGsTE{background:rgba(255,204,132,.14);color:#ffd59c}@media (max-width:760px){.site-map_hero__aKTfQ{padding:20px 18px;border-radius:22px}.site-map_sectionCard__YezI9{padding:18px 16px;border-radius:20px}.site-map_linksGrid__utbfs{grid-template-columns:1fr}}